Many AA meetings happen in remedy services. Carrying the concept of AA into hospitals was how the co-founders of AA first remained sober. They uncovered wonderful worth in working with alcoholics who remain suffering, and that regardless of whether the alcoholic they were being dealing with did not keep sober, they did.[86][87][88] Bill W. wrote, "Simple knowledge shows that practically nothing will so much insure immunity from drinking as intensive operate with other alcoholics".[89] Invoice Wilson visited Cities Medical center in Ny city in an make an effort to assistance the alcoholics who have been individuals there in 1934.

AA's emphasis over the spiritual character of its program, nevertheless, is essential to institutionalize a sense of transcendence. A pressure results from the danger the requirement of transcendence, if taken too actually, would compromise AA's endeavours to maintain a wide appeal. As this rigidity is really an integral A part of AA, Rudy and Greil argue that AA is greatest referred to as a quasi-spiritual Group.[134]
The Twelve Actions define a prompt system of ongoing drug rehabilitation and self-improvement. A important part includes seeking alignment or divining using a personally outlined notion of "God as we recognized Him".[a] The techniques start with an acknowledgment of powerlessness around alcohol and also the unmanageability of lifetime as a result of alcoholism. Subsequent techniques emphasize rigorous honesty, including the completion of the "searching and fearless moral inventory", acknowledgment of "character defects", sharing the inventory that has a trusted person, producing amends to persons harmed, and fascinating in common prayer or meditation to hunt "acutely aware connection with God" and steerage in next divine will.
